Opened 10 years ago

Last modified 4 years ago

#3146 closed defect

Impossible to use "redeclare" in an "extends" — at Initial Version

Reported by: rolandrenier@… Owned by: Adeel Asghar
Priority: high Milestone: 1.16.0
Component: New Instantiation Version: trunk
Keywords: Cc: Adrian Pop

Description

model A1

replaceable package Medium = Modelica.Media.Interfaces.PartialMedium;

end A1;

model A2

A1 a1;

end A2;

model A3

extends A2(a1(redeclare package Medium = Modelica.Media.Air.ReferenceAir.Air_ph));

end A3;

The model A3 does not run and print this message error:
"Error: Variable a1: In modifier redeclare(Medium), class or component Medium not found in <test2.A1$a1>."

Version: 1.9.1 r22929

Change History (0)

Note: See TracTickets for help on using tickets.